    You can set up an iCloud account which makes the iCloud email address you choose the Apple ID and thus the login for it:
    https://discussions.apple.com/message/22283348#22283348
    though I have to say I think it's more sensible if the ID is another address, both for security reasons (so people don't know what the login is) and as a contact address from Apple if the account were to stop working and they needed to contact you. So personally I would to to System Preferences, enter the GMail address which is an ID, and then choose a nerw @icloud.com address.
    If she has her own iCloud account she will need either her own computer or her own user account on your Mac to be able to make use of it. You should note that under Apple's terms of use Apple IDs are only available to children of 13 and over.
    As to purchasing apps, this is nothing to do with iCloud: it's iTunes, and the login can be different. So you can all sign into the same iTunes account but have different iCloud accounts. Or she can have her own iTunes account if she is of suitable age (credit card needed for purchasing apps).
    If you have other children you should be aware that any one Mac or device can create only three iCloud accounts - this is tied to the serial number, not the user account, and once reached cannot be bypassed. You can of course sign into an iCloud account created on another device.

    To change the iCloud ID you have to go to Settings>iCloud, tap Delete Account, provide the password for the old ID when prompted to turn off Find My iDevice, then sign back in with the ID you wish to use.  If you don't know the password for your old ID, or if it isn't accepted, and your old ID is an earlier version of your current ID, go to https://appleid.apple.com, click Manage my Apple ID and sign in with your current iCloud ID.  Click edit next to the primary email account, change it back to your old email address and save the change.  Then edit the name of the account to change it back to your old email address.  You can now use your current password to turn off Find My iDevice on your device, even though it prompts you for the password for your old account ID. Then save any photo stream photos that you wish to keep to your camera roll.  When finished go to Settings>iCloud, tap Delete Account and choose Delete from My iDevice when prompted (your iCloud data will still be in iCloud).  Next, go back to https://appleid.apple.com and change your primary email address and iCloud ID name back to the way it was.  Now you can go to Settings>iCloud and sign in with your current iCloud ID and password.

    Captive portal/wispr support for apple ios7
    CSCuj18674
    Description
    Symptom:
    When attempting to access the Guest Portal with an Apple iOS 7 device while the WLC "Captive Portal Bypass" feature is enabled, the web sheet on the device still appears, preventing the user from continuing the flow.
    Conditions:
    The Apple device is running Apple iOS 7.
    Workaround:
    In the ACL on the WLC used for captive portal redirection and exemption of special traffic for the Guest Portal, add exemptions for the IP resources that resolve from "www.appleiphonecell.com" and "captive.apple.com" FQDNs.
    IMPORTANT NOTE: These IP addresses are associated with the FQDNs of "www.appleiphonecell.com" and "captive.apple.com" and are subject to change by the entities hosting those domains. If the IP addresses do change, the ACL would need to reflect that.
